开发者社区 > 大数据与机器学习 > 大数据开发治理DataWorks > 正文

请问一下R语言怎么连接我们的数据库呢

请问一下R语言怎么连接我们的数据库呢

展开
收起
xin在这 2023-04-20 08:11:45 126 0
3 条回答
写回答
取消 提交回答
  • 值得去的地方都没有捷径

    要连接数据库,需要使用R语言中的DBI和RMySQL等包。具体步骤如下:

    安装DBI和RMySQL包 install.packages("DBI") install.packages("RMySQL") r 加载DBI和RMySQL包 library(DBI) library(RMySQL) r 连接数据库 con <- dbConnect(MySQL(), dbname = "database_name", host = "localhost", port = 3306, user = "user_name", password = "password") r 其中,dbname是数据库名称,host是数据库主机地址,port是数据库端口号,user是数据库用户名,password是数据库密码。

    查询数据 dbGetQuery(con, "SELECT * FROM table_name") r 其中,table_name是要查询的表名。

    关闭数据库连接 dbDisconnect(con) r 以上就是使用R语言连接数据库的基本步骤。需要注意的是,连接数据库需要提供正确的数据库信息和凭证。

    2023-04-20 19:06:04
    赞同 展开评论 打赏
  • 得问一下对应云产品的同学看有没有对应的连接方式,此回答整理自钉群“DataWorks交流群(答疑@机器人)”

    2023-04-20 11:16:21
    赞同 展开评论 打赏
  • R语言可以通过ODBC驱动程序来连接各种类型的数据库(如MySQL、Oracle、SQL Server等)。下面是连接数据库的一般步骤:

    安装ODBC驱动程序 在使用ODBC驱动程序之前,需要先安装相应的驱动程序。例如,如果要连接MySQL数据库,则需要安装MySQL ODBC驱动程序。

    配置ODBC数据源 在R语言中,可以使用odbc包来管理ODBC数据源。在连接数据库之前,需要先创建一个ODBC数据源,指定数据库的名称和连接信息。

    2023-04-20 10:43:18
    赞同 展开评论 打赏

DataWorks基于MaxCompute/Hologres/EMR/CDP等大数据引擎,为数据仓库/数据湖/湖仓一体等解决方案提供统一的全链路大数据开发治理平台。

相关电子书

更多
2022 DTCC-阿里云一站式数据库上云最佳实践 立即下载
云时代的数据库技术趋势 立即下载
超大型金融机构国产数据库全面迁移成功实践 立即下载